Louisiana's commodities market is booming, with prices on the rise for key agricultural products such as soybeans, sugar, and rice. This positive trend is a welcome relief for farmers and investors in the state, who have faced challenges in recent years due to fluctuating prices and unpredictable weather conditions.One of the main drivers of this growth has been increasing demand for Louisiana's agricultural products both domestically and internationally. With the global population continuing to grow, there is a growing need for food and other commodities, and Louisiana's fertile land and favorable climate make it an ideal location for producing a variety of crops.Soybean prices have seen a particularly sharp increase, with the price per bushel reaching a 10-year high. This is good news for Louisiana farmers, who have been expanding their soybean crops in recent years to meet the growing demand both at home and abroad. Increased interest in plant-based proteins has also contributed to this surge in soybean prices.Sugar production in Louisiana has also been on the rise, with prices for raw sugar climbing steadily over the past year. This is due in part to a strong demand for sugar in the United States, as well as increased interest in natural sweeteners as consumers become more health-conscious.Rice, another key commodity for Louisiana, has also seen a boost in prices as demand for this staple crop remains strong both domestically and internationally. With Louisiana being one of the top rice-producing states in the country, this increase in prices is a welcome development for rice farmers in the state.Overall, the commodities market in Louisiana is experiencing a period of growth and stability, providing a much-needed boost to the state's agricultural industry. As farmers continue to innovate and adapt to changing market conditions, the future looks bright for Louisiana's commodities sector.
